Essential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
Almond Flour: Opt for finely ground almond flour to ensure a smooth texture; this is key for that melt-in-your-mouth experience.
Granulated Sugar: Use regular granulated sugar for sweetness; feel free to adjust according to your taste preference.
Eggs: Fresh eggs provide structure and moisture; I recommend using large eggs for the best results.
Baking Powder: This is essential for giving the cake its fluffiness; ensure it’s fresh for optimal rise.
Unsalted Butter: I prefer using unsalted butter so I can control the saltiness while adding richness to the cake.
Vanilla Extract: Pure vanilla extract elevates the flavor profile; it’s worth avoiding imitation versions here.
Milk: Whole milk provides moisture and fat; consider using buttermilk for added tanginess if desired.
Sliced Almonds: These are optional but add an incredible crunch and visual appeal on top of the cake.

Let’s Make it Together
Preheat Your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and line an 8-inch round cake pan with parchment paper for easy removal later.
Cream Butter and Sugar: In a large mixing bowl, cream together softened unsalted butter and granulated sugar until fluffy and pale. The mixture should look light and airy after about 3-5 minutes.
Add Eggs and Vanilla: Beat in the eggs one at a time while mixing on low speed. Add in pure vanilla extract before continuing to mix until everything is well combined.
Mix Dry Ingredients: In another bowl, whisk together almond flour, baking powder, and a pinch of salt. Gradually add this dry mixture into the wet ingredients while mixing gently until just combined.
Add Milk and Fold Gently: Pour in whole milk and fold the batter gently until fully incorporated. Be careful not to overmix; you want an airy texture that will rise beautifully in the oven.
Pour and Decorate Before Baking: Transfer the batter into your prepared cake pan. Sprinkle sliced almonds on top if using—they’ll toast beautifully while baking, adding both crunch and elegance!
Bake for 25-30 minutes or until golden brown on top. A toothpick inserted should come out clean—no sticky batter allowed! Let it cool before removing from the pan.

Storing & Reheating
Store the cake in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days. For longer storage, freeze slices wrapped in plastic wrap.

Delightful Mother’s Day Almond Cake
- Total Time: 45 minutes
- Yield: Serves approximately 10 slices 1x

Ingredients
- 2 cups almond flour
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 4 large eggs
- 1 tsp baking powder
- ½ cup unsalted butter (softened)
- 2 tsp pure vanilla extract
- ½ cup whole milk
- ¼ cup sliced almonds (optional)
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and line an 8-inch round cake pan with parchment paper.
- In a large bowl, cream together softened unsalted butter and granulated sugar until light and fluffy (3-5 minutes).
- Add the eggs one at a time, mixing on low speed after each addition. Stir in vanilla extract.
- In another bowl, whisk almond flour, baking powder, and a pinch of salt together. Gradually mix into the wet ingredients until just combined.
- Gently fold in whole milk until fully incorporated without overmixing.
- Pour batter into prepared pan, sprinkle sliced almonds on top if desired, and bake for 25-30 minutes or until golden brown and a toothpick comes out clean.
- Let cool before removing from the pan.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
